Chronic kidney disease (CKD) is a public health problem affecting the patients to suffer, reduce their quality of life, and loss of many expenses. CKD in the early stages is usually without abnormal symptoms. Most patients are unaware that they have kidney disease, usually diagnosed when the disease has severely progressed. Inclusion criteria
Inclusion criteria: 1. Male or female participants aged between 35- 85 years 2. Participants with stage 3B chronic kidney disease and had an eGFR between 30-44 ml / min / 173m2.
Exclusion criteria
Exclusion criteria: 1. Participants with cancer of all types from the first stage onwards 2. Participants with heart disease or heart abnormality in all cases 3. Participants with liver disease, hepatitis, cirrhosis, fatty liver 4. Participants with diabetic nephropathy 5. Participants with chronic infection and are undergoing treatment for an infection 6. Participants with alcoholism 7. Participants with autoimmune disease, SLE, rheumatoid arthritis and are taking corticosteroids, immunosuppressants or immunosuppressive agents 8. Participants with during of pregnant or breastfeeding 9. Participants with history of lemongrass allergy 10. Participants with prolonged obstruction of the urinary tract, such as enlarged prostate and kidney stones 11. Participants with overactive bladder (OAB) 12. Participants currently participating in another study
